Replace SAS 300Gb 15K of VRTX

Hi Dell expert !

I am using VRTX with 3 server blades. I created 3 group of RAID : group 1: 8ea x 300 GB 15K, group 2:6ea x 900 GB 10K, group 3 :9 ea x 1.2 TB 10K and all groups are RAID 5. Quorum disk was created on group 1. Now, the storage space of 3 groups disk near reach to limit and I plan to replace 8ea x 300Gb 15K SAS disks with 8 ea x 1.2 TB 10K disks. To do this task, I plan moving all data, Hyper-V host stored on group 1 to another group. After that I will shut down VRTX and replace these disk, plug in new disks and create RAID again. But I don't know these steps that I plan are right or not? How about Quorum disk will be created automatically or I have to do it by myself?

Please give me advise for my case? Thanks

SamAn83,

With the system being a VRTX then the process of;

1. Backing up the data

2. Deleting the Virtual Disk

3. Replace the drives

4. Recreate the Virtual Disk

5. Reinstall the OS

6. Restore the data from back up

is the only option, as the VRTX doesn't support OCE (Online Capacity Expansion).
